BACKGROUND: H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) with a tumor thrombus in the inferior vena cava (IVC) and right atrium (RA) rarely occurs and is usually associated with extremely poor prognosis, we carried out this study to evaluate the efficacy and safety of a combination of trans-arterial chemoembolization (TACE) and external beam radiation therapy (EBRT) in the treatment of HCC with a tumor thrombus in the IVC and RA.Entities:

Patient characteristics (at diagnosis of tumor thrombus in IVC/RA
| Case | Age | Gender | Etiology | Pathology | Intrahepatic tumor size (cm) | AFP (μg/L) | Survival time (months) | Status |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 54 | M | Hepatitis B | Moderately differentiated HCC | 7 | 16.74 | 21 | Dead |
| 2 | 44 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 5 | 322.11 | 97 | Alive |
| 3 | 30 | F | Hepatitis B | NA | 11 | 1210 | 11 | Lost |
| 4 | 55 | M | Hepatitis B | Poorly differentiated HCC | 6 | 2.01 | 24 | Dead |
| 5 | 53 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 5 | 1,105 | 66 | Alive |
| 6 | 40 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 6.5 | 390.68 | 25 | Dead |
| 7 | 48 | M | Hepatitis B | Moderately differentiated HCC | 10.5 | >24,200 | 8 | Dead |
| 8 | 61 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 10 | 1,503 | 9 | Lost |
| 9 | 74 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 9.5 | 903 | 10 | Dead |
| 10 | 64 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 9 | 1,842 | 7 | Lost |
| 11 | 48 | M | Hepatitis B | NA | 6.5 | >20,000 | 36 | Dead |
Fig. 1Overall survival of the entire group of patients. Median survival: 21.0 months
